About Memory CareMemory care facilities provide housing, care, and therapies for seniors who have Alzheimer’s disease or other forms of dementia in an environment designed to reduce confusion and prevent wandering. Complete guide to memory careBest of 2025 Memory Care Winners

Senior living costs in Tracy vs. state and national costs

Cost comparison table showing community type costs by location. This table contains 3 rows of data across 4 columns.
Column communityType: Community type
Column destination: Tracy, TX
Column state: Texas
Column national: U.S.
Community typeTracy, TXTexasU.S.
Independent Living$4,124/mo$4,243/mo$4,153/mo
Assisted Living$5,075/mo$4,771/mo$4,698/mo
Memory Care$5,252/mo$4,936/mo$4,946/mo
